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
81298644137 450 70 854270
154804157 57289255
154804157 57289255
94253 96186462 3193571 7874157
All about undefined
Interested in learning more?
154804157 57289255
94253 96186462 3193571 7874157
See more
59417 0436 5829
82093 810001769 274788283
See more
2585899 386894421 92771437566
2349714 867 89
See more